Brooke and I cover that in a June 2017 piece in the R Journal (but web site down today). In short, `drat` can set up a repo for those packages, and the 'Additional_repositories' field can point to it. As your code is already conditional, that may be all you need. #rstats

You can probably use the standard trick one uses in other circumstance (i.e. @Rdatatable columns names flagged as unknown globals): `tools::globalVariables(c("This", "And", "That"))` #rstats

Using #RStats on @Ubuntu LTS cloud, server, desktop? The new #CRANapt repo has 19000 .deb binaries with full dependencies and `apt` integration. Demo of a full `tidyverse` installation in 18 seconds (on @awscloud) below. More details at eddelbuettel.github.io/r2u/
